Backflow testing services involve inspecting and evaluating a property’s backflow prevention devices to ensure they are functioning correctly. These devices are installed in plumbing systems to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ply. During a backflow test, technicians assess the device’s operational integrity, checking for any signs of malfunction or wear that could compromise water safety. Regular testing helps maintain the effectiveness of these devices, ensuring the water supply remains safe and uncontaminated.
One of the primary issues backflow testing addresses is the risk of water contamination caused by backflow events. When backflow occurs, potentially hazardous substances from irrigation systems, industrial processes, or other sources can enter the drinking water system. This contamination can pose health risks and violate local water safety regulations. Routine testing and maintenance of backflow prevention devices help identify problems early, preventing costly damage and safeguarding public health.
Properties that typically require backflow testing include residential homes, comm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and multi-unit complexes. Residential properties with irrigation systems or well connections often need regular testing to comply with local codes and ensure water safety. Commercial establishments such as restaurants, offices, and retail stores also rely on backflow testing to prevent contamination and meet health and safety standards. Additionally, industrial sites with process water or chemical handling systems usually require more frequent inspections to mitigate potential backflow risks.

What is backflow testing? Backflow testing is a procedure to check whether the backflow prevention devices in a plumbing system are functioning properly to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ply.
Why is backflow testing important? Regular backflow testing helps ensure the safety and quality of the water supply by verifying that backflow prevention devices are working correctly to prevent potential contamination.
How often should backflow testing be performed? It is generally recommended to have backflow prevention devices tested annually by qualified service providers.
What does a backflow testing service include? A typical backflow testing service involves inspecting the device, performing operational tests, and providing documentation of the device’s condition.
